The mineralized interval represents a true width of approximately 5.5 m within the\n \n Zone 1\n \n structure.\n \n\n This is the\n \n deepest interval on Zone 1\n \n so far indicating that\n \n the mineralization is open at depth.\n \n This hole was drilled in the eastern portion of Zone 1, approximately 125m to the east of the previously announced hole NO-25-05. The mineralized zone is strong and appears to represent an important vector of high grade within Zone 1.\n \n\n Hole NO-25-10a was drilled closer to surface to test the western extension of Zone 1. It returned a marginal value of 1.54 g/t Au over 2.2 m (true width of 1.54m) from 160.3 to 162.5 m. It also retuned an interval of 2.63 g/t Au over 3.2 m (true width of 2.29 m) from 175.2 to 178.4 m.\n \n\n Hole NO-25-11 was drilled 100 m above and to the west of the previous one to test the same possible extension of Zone 1. It also returned a marginal value of 1.56 g/t Au over 1.8 m from 111.8 to 113.6 m (true width of 1.5 m).\n \n\n Hole NO-25-12 is an in-fill drill hole located nearly 200 m to the east of NO-25-10a. It returned\n \n 2.24 g/t Au over 6.6 m\n \n (true width of 5.5 m) from 188.1 to 194.7m, at a vertical depth of approximately 175m.
